Kamaldins pegged for top spot

  • 1999-04-01
RIGA (BNS) - The National Security Council has apparently overlooked controversial comments about last year's synagogue bombing by intelligence chief Lainis Kamaldins, but the Parliament may not be as forgiving.The council renominated Kamaldins as head of the Constitutional Protection Office, Latvia's top intelligence organization, but the Latvian Social Democratic Alliance and the For Human Rights in a United Latvia factions have said they will not support him.Kamaldins' term in office expires April 12.
